Test and results:
*Using slow sniper rifle to avoid triggering too many possible extra effects.
3600 Normal shot.
11k NormCrit.
14k SkillCrit with Guerrilla
20k SkillCrit without Guerrilla
Now: lets count 10 shots with calculator. Again, to avoid triggering extra bonuses.
11x10=110k NormCrit.
14x10=140k SkillCrit with Guerrilla
20x3+11x7=137k SkillCrit without Guerrilla
Now: lets count 20 shots with calculator. Again, to avoid triggering extra bonuses.
11x20=220k NormCrit.
14x20=280k SkillCrit with Guerilla
20x3+11x17=247k SkillCrit without Guerrilla
So, Guerrillas WIN even before those notes:
1. You need to aim perfectly or be lucky to get 20 Normal crits in a row.
2. You need to aim perfectly ot be lucky to get 17 Normal crits in a row after using a skill.
3. Guerilla guarantees all the crits you can put in 5 second window.
Fade without Guerrillas in the Mist is simply: longer duration, 3 guaranteed crits (assuming you land all 3 shots.)
Fade WITH Guerrillas in the Mist is a shorter duration, but you can fire more than 3 crit shots (again, assuming you land all of them) at the cost of possibly reduced damage. I still explain further. Guerrillas add 25% of crit damage instead of 200%
If u read my test result above you will see something further interesting.
That those numbers might be confusing too.
Actually it seems to be:
Fadeaway: 200% Crit or actually: +100%
Guerrillas: 125% Crit or actually + 25%
Since it might seem like Guerrillas nerf your crit 175% but it nerfs 75% actually.
